Neighborhood Overview
Located in the northern part of Fresno, the Bullard Talent Project sits within a developing area known for its blend of residential neighborhoods and emerging commercial zones. Access to the venue is primarily facilitated by North Harrison Avenue, a key thoroughfare connecting to larger city arteries like Herndon Avenue and Highway 41. This strategic positioning allows for relatively straightforward access from various parts of Fresno and surrounding regions. Parking is generally available on-site, though demand can increase significantly during major events, making early arrival or alternative transportation a good consideration. Fresno Yosemite International Airport (FAT) is the nearest major airport, typically a 20-30 minute drive from the venue depending on traffic conditions. Utilizing rideshare services or pre-arranged shuttles can be efficient for group travel, especially for those unfamiliar with the city's layout. When planning your arrival, factor in potential traffic, particularly during peak commute hours or when large events are scheduled at the complex, as local roads can experience congestion.

Things to Do
Walkable
Woodward Park
1.5 miWoodward Park is Fresno's largest municipal park and a significant green space offering a wide array of recreational opportunities for visitors of all ages. Spanning over 300 acres, it features extensive walking and biking trails, beautiful Japanese gardens, a memorial rose garden, and a tranquil lake. Families can enjoy playgrounds, picnic areas, and open fields perfect for casual sports or relaxation. The park also hosts numerous community events, concerts, and festivals throughout the year, making it a dynamic destination for both active enjoyment and passive leisure. Its proximity makes it an excellent option for a pre- or post-event outing.
Shinzen Japanese Garden
1.5 miNestled within Woodward Park, the Shinzen Japanese Garden offers a serene escape with its meticulously maintained landscapes, koi ponds, and traditional structures. This peaceful oasis provides a contemplative space to enjoy the beauty of Japanese garden design, complete with stone lanterns, bridges, and carefully pruned trees. It's an ideal spot for quiet reflection, photography, or a leisurely stroll amidst stunning natural and architectural elements. The garden's tranquility offers a perfect contrast to the energetic atmosphere of sports competitions, providing a unique cultural experience easily accessible from the Bullard Talent Project.
5–15 Minutes Away
River Park Shopping Center
3.1 miRiver Park is a sprawling outdoor shopping and entertainment complex that offers a diverse range of retail stores, restaurants, and entertainment venues. Visitors can find everything from popular fashion brands and electronics to a large movie theater and a bowling alley. The center's pedestrian-friendly layout, complete with fountains and public art, makes it a pleasant place to spend time browsing, dining, or catching a film. Its proximity to the Bullard Talent Project makes it a convenient destination for families and teams looking for dining, shopping, or entertainment options before or after their scheduled activities.
Fresno Chaffee Zoo
5.2 miThe Fresno Chaffee Zoo is a well-regarded zoological park offering an engaging experience with a variety of animal exhibits from around the world. Highlights include a spacious African savanna exhibit, a fascinating reptile house, and a lively sea lion pool. The zoo is committed to conservation and education, providing informative displays and interactive experiences for visitors of all ages. It's a popular family destination that offers a fun and educational outing, perfect for a break from sports events or for exploring the local attractions with children.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Fresno brings cool temperatures, typically ranging from the high 30s to mid-50s Fahrenheit. Days can be sunny but often carry a chill, so layering clothing is recommended. Pack sweaters, light jackets, and comfortable pants. Outdoor events are generally manageable, though rain is a possibility, so bringing a waterproof jacket or umbrella is wise for ensuring comfort during transitions or breaks.
Spring & early summer
Spring ushers in warmer, pleasant weather, with temperatures gradually rising from the 60s into the 80s Fahrenheit. This is an ideal time for outdoor sports, with comfortable conditions for both participants and spectators. Light jackets or long-sleeved shirts are usually sufficient for mornings and evenings, while t-shirts and shorts are perfect for daytime activities. Humidity is generally low, making it comfortable to be outdoors.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in Fresno is characterized by intense heat, with daytime temperatures routinely exceeding 90°F and often climbing above 100°F. Light, breathable clothing like t-shirts, shorts, and hats is essential. Staying hydrated is paramount; carry water bottles and utilize any shaded areas or indoor facilities during the hottest parts of the day. Plan strenuous activities for early morning or late evening to avoid heat exhaustion.
Fall season
Fall offers a transition back to milder temperatures, starting in the 70s and gradually cooling into the 60s Fahrenheit as the season progresses. This period is excellent for outdoor events, providing comfortable conditions similar to spring. Light layers remain useful, as mornings can be cool before warming up in the afternoon. It's a popular time for sports due to the pleasant climate, making it comfortable for everyone involved.
Rain & snow
Rain is most common during the winter months in Fresno, typically occurring in the form of moderate to heavy downpours. Snowfall within the city is extremely rare. Visitors should pack waterproof outerwear, umbrellas, and footwear suitable for wet conditions. Indoor alternatives and flexible scheduling are advisable during periods of significant rainfall to avoid disruption to outdoor activities and travel.
